 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Keeping Well by Using Your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act Plan- Directs the Secretary of Health and Human Services (HHS) to conduct outreach efforts to provide specified health information to: (1) individuals enrolled in qualified health plans offered through an Exchange established under the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act (PPACA), and (2) individuals enrolled in state plans (or under a waiver of such a plan) under title XIX (Medicaid) of the Social Security Act.

Directs the Secretary to report to Congress on: (1) the median cost-sharing responsibility of health services under qualified health plans offered through an Exchange in each state, and (2) the best method for making such information public.
